1. STOP THE WAR

The War in Iraq is a “war of aggression” by international, and therefore American, standards, the “supreme international crime,” because it was not approved by the UN Security Council, and there was no legitimate threat to the United States.

We were literally tricked into believing that Iraq and Saddam Hussein were somehow connected to 9/11, with justifications like WMDs and terrorist links, which have repeatedly and widely been proven false. (see Article I for Bush under “3. Impeach Bush and Cheney”)

The justification then moved to the “liberation of the Iraqi people,” though most see us as an occupying force, not liberators. A million Iraqis and over 3,000 of our brave men and women have been killed based on blatant, self-serving lies.

We are not acting as a liberating police force; we are acting like an aggressive outlaw state. We are not more secure, in life or in freedom, since we invaded Iraq: we are in much more danger than ever (see “the War INCREASES TERRORISM”).

We must stop the war because it’s illegal, counterproductive, and wrong. And especially, we must stop the war because we CAN.
